Always Work With an Insured Contractor
Roofing Contractors Near Me Socastee
One of the most unsafe occupations in the world is roofing. Several falls happen every year which trigger injury and also some are fatal. If the roof firm does not have proper insurance coverage then points can get truly negative truly quickly. Many roof covering companies that are appropriately certified will certainly carry sufficient insurance policy and will certainly have not a problem showing you proof of that insurance prior to the job begins. If a roof company is not insured and a mishap were to happen the responsibility may stay with the resident. That implies your property owner insurance policy will be liable in some cases. You will likely face higher rates for many years. While an accident may not take place, it's ideal not to take opportunities and ensure the roofer is insured.

Demand a Contract for the Job
The most effective means to shield yourself from rip-offs and also various other problems for a roof covering job is to have a contract which details the roofing project from beginning to end. If the roofing contractor is reliable and also certified they will additionally demand a roof agreement. It not only aids the home owner but it also aids the contractor tremendously. It clears up any type of misconceptions and makes sure every little thing is accounted for. As a property owner you need to get a duplicate of the agreement and also go over it with your contractor. If there is any type of point that requires to be added or that you have a concern about it's ideal to bring it up now before you sign it. Always insist on a contract even for tiny jobs.

Lien Waiver
Situation: Your roof is already finished as well as you paid the expert. However, a couple of weeks later, the expert's representative calls you requesting a settlement for the items installed on your roof. You discover that your roofing professional did not pay his representative which is you are currently accountable of that negotiation. This has in fact happened and can also occur to you.
Option: Make certain that you request a lien waiver as soon as the job is done before spending for the solution. This lien waiver merely specifies that if the professional can not make his settlements to a supplier or employees, you are exempt to cover them. The lien waiver ends up being conditional upon your repayment. Nevertheless, as soon as you clear your repayment, the lien waiver ends up being genuine.

How much does it cost to tear off and replace a roof?
First, roofers charge labor for removing your old roof. A one-story roof with a single shingle layer costs between $100 and $150 per square to remove; a double layer, $115 to $165; and triple layer, $125 to $175. If you have a particularly high roof or one that is extremely steep, you will pay more per square.Apr 30, 2013

The most common are the asphalt types that cost around $80 to $100 per square. A square covers approximately one hundred square feet. There are also wood shingles or "shakes" (which are the types cut by hand instead of machine), and BuildDirect.com places the average cost of a square of cedar shingles at $160.
When calculating roofing costs per square, asphalt shingles run from $350 and $500 per square, metal or tin roofs costs $600 to $1,200 per square, and concrete or clay costs between $1,200 and $1,800 per square. If you are replacing your current roof, add $125 to $500 per roofing square for old roof removal.
